From editor or global species database
Diagnosis Antedonidae with centrodorsal conical, not higher than wide, with sockets in 10 columns, separated interradially by naked, shallow groove. Proximal brachials smooth, cylindrical, and not in lateral contact. Single known specimen has 14 arms; synarthry between primibrachials 1 and 2; secundibrachials with an axil at second or fourth ossicle or undivided; placement of syzygies depends on whether the secundibrachial series is part of the undivided arm (syzygy between secundibrachials 3 and 4) or terminates in an axil and ray division (no syzygy between secundibrachials 3 and 4). [details]
